
Australasian Occupational Diver Training needed a new website to support professional training delivery while presenting a large volume of course information in a clear and organised way. The client had a defined visual direction and required a site build that followed this closely, while also improving how courses, locations, and upcoming intakes were structured and maintained. The website needed to balance strong imagery with concise information, guide users towards enquiries and course dates, and remain easy to manage internally.

An important focus of the build was organising courses in a logical and easy-to-navigate layout. Users can quickly understand course options, prerequisites, and progression pathways without working through dense or confusing content. Imagery from real training scenarios and environments reinforces the level of expertise on offer, helping set expectations for prospective students.
Webflow CMS plays a central role across the site, powering course listings, individual course pages, location details, and upcoming intake schedules, all displayed in structured, easy-to-read formats. This allows AODT to manage and update content without technical support, keeping information accurate and current as new courses and locations are added.
